- Wildfires Force Evacuation of Jasper National Park in Canada

A wildfire in Jasper, Alberta has destroyed hundreds of structures, making it the largest blaze in the area in over a century. The fire has burned through approximately a third of the town's buildings, raising concerns about preparedness and the impact of climate change. The area received some rain, but it was not enough to stop the spread of the fire. Over 20,000 residents were ordered to evacuate, and the fire is expected to continue burning for at least three months.
